Panchkula district administration has started a new initiative for quick resolution of public complaints. Samadhan camps will be organized every week on Monday and Thursday from 10 am to 12 noon. Deputy Commissioner Monica Gupta directed the officers to settle complaints on priority basis in the camp organized in the Mini Secretariat Auditorium today (June 2).
In the camp, the Deputy Commissioner ordered DCP Panchkula to investigate the land related complaint of Vinay Dhiman, resident of Baltana. Chief Minister Naib Singh Saini himself is monitoring these camps. This will ensure accountability and transparency at the administrative level.
These problems will be resolved in the camp
Problems ranging from family identity card, property ID, land registry, map approval to pension and ration card are resolved in the camp. Also, complaints related to electricity-water, health services and other civic amenities are settled on the spot.
The Deputy Commissioner heard the complaints of 21 people
In today’s camp, the Deputy Commissioner heard the complaints of 21 people. During this, Additional Deputy Commissioner Nisha Yadav, SDM Chandrakant Kataria and Nagaradhis Vishwanath were present. Officers from various departments including Haryana Urban Development Authority, District Development, Panchayat, Education, Health, Police were also present.
